Eric Bostrom is a legend amongst two-wheeled motor racing enthusiasts. As a multi-time champion road racer and Flat-Track star "E-Boz" was known to be tenacious, hard working, and full of talent.
But after a heavy crash that left him with a compressed cervical spine, and a diagnosis that recommended giving up his active lifestyle, he refused to quit or accept what the doctors said was a 'hard truth'. It was then that he turned his attention to self-healing and developing a tool that could be used to relieve tension in the body, stimulate blood flow, and ultimately improve quality of life. The result was The Backmate Self-Massager, but more than a product, this extensive research and experience helped E-Boz understand that a pursuit of wellness is important for every Athlete as they seek performance gains. In this episode of the BWC Podcast, Coach Brian talks performance and wellness with Mr Bostrom to shed some light on why "self-care" is equal in importance to the hard efforts of training.
